Virtualization is changing the data center architecture and as a result, data protection is is quickly evolving as well. This unique book, written by an industry expert with over eighteen years of data storage/backup experience, shows you how to approach, protect, and manage data in a virtualized environment. You'll get up to speed on data protection problems, explore the data protection technologies available today, see how to adapt to virtualization, and more. The book uses a "good, better, best" approach, exploring best practices for backup, high availability, disaster recovery, business continuity, and more.

-Covers best practices and essential information on protecting data in virtualized enterprise environments

-Shows you how to approach, protect, and manage data while also meeting such challenges as return on investment, existing service level agreements (SLAs), and more

-Helps system and design architects understand data protection issues and technologies in advance, so they can design systems to meet the challenges

-Explains how to make absolutely critical services such as file services and e-mail more available without sacrificing protection

-Offers best practices and solutions for backup, availability, disaster recovery, and others

-This is a must-have guide for any Windows server and application administrator who is charged with data recovery and maintaining higher uptimes.
